Output 76e0fc44c1eebc32e3b680cf377ec26e793fa64164c9f4c5620ab6bd5ef2cd5d:6

value
75841618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 375475739741994f5bba0110424fb3e53ad26b6e OP_EQUAL
address
MCwiaHEvZpGYnrLZYe1XJ3ZPF46f7J5Xn3
transaction
76e0fc44c1eebc32e3b680cf377ec26e793fa64164c9f4c5620ab6bd5ef2cd5d
spent
true